Understanding Car Polish

Car polish is a specialized product designed to restore, protect, and enhance the paintwork of vehicles. Types of Car Polish

Car polish comes in various formulations tailored to specific needs and preferences:

  2. All-in-One Polish: Combining polishing and waxing properties in a single product, all-in-one polish offers convenience and efficiency, making it suitable for routine maintenance and minor touch-ups.
  3. Finishing Polish: Used as a final step in the polishing process, finishing polish removes fine scratches and enhances gloss, leaving behind a smooth and mirror-like finish.
  4. Synthetic Polish: Formulated with synthetic polymers, synthetic polish provides long-lasting protection and a high-gloss shine, making it an excellent choice for enthusiasts seeking durability and performance.

Application Techniques

Achieving professional-quality results with car polish requires proper technique and attention to detail:

  1. Surface Preparation: Start by washing and drying your car thoroughly to remove dirt, grime, and contaminants that could interfere with the polishing process.
  2. Test in an Inconspicuous Area: Before applying polish to the entire vehicle, test it in a small, inconspicuous area to ensure compatibility and assess the desired level of correction.
  3. Apply Polish with Appropriate Tools: Use a foam or microfiber applicator pad to apply car polish evenly, working in small sections to ensure thorough coverage.
  4. Buffing and Polishing: Once the polish has dried to a haze, use a clean, soft microfiber towel to buff the surface in circular motions, revealing a brilliant shine.
  5. Follow Up with Wax: For added protection and gloss, consider applying a coat of car wax after polishing to seal the surface and prolong the shine.
